What Does Deck Gauge Mean . Metal decking is corrugated metal sheeting that’s used as a structural roof deck or composite floor deck. This means that in order to ensure your material meets the correct dimensional requirements for your project, you must use the. Metal decking is most commonly 16, 18, 20, and 22 gauge in thickness. Gauge is a measure of thickness for sheet metal. The metal deck gauge is a unit of measurement that refers to the thickness of the steel. A structural engineer will call for 20 gauge steel deck, for example, or a. The higher the gauge number the thinner the steel. The higher the gauge number the thinner the steel.
